Johan van Zyl

Johan van Zyl

Director

A practicing attorney, conveyancer and director of various boards, Johan distinguishes himself as a property and commercial legal specialist.

Capable of handling all legal aspects of property development, from inception to conclusion, Johan offers pivotal assistance to property developers and is often integral to successfully negotiating various large commercial transactions.

Johan’s position as legal representative of the Public Investments Corporation, one of the largest investment managers on the African continent managing in excess of R1,4-trillion, is a testament to the extent of his experience, expertise and knowledge in the property and commercial fields.

Having grown up in various different countries and lived with many different nationalities and cultures, Johan has a natural ease and open-minded approach to his many different clients which include listed companies, family businesses, property developers, investors and BEE-empowered companies.

The broad expanse of Johan’s network promises any company wishing to excel in the residential and commercial property market the opportunity to unlock opportunity.

Johan started the practice in 1998 under the now defunct JL van Zyl Attorneys and Associates and in March 2008 sold his practice to wessels + van zyl inc. Johan is the managing director of wessels + van zyl inc.

He is also an admitted solicitor in the UK and Wales (non-practicing) and has settled various international commercial agreements in the IT, mobile, mining, clothing and franchise industries.

Suré obtained her Bachelors of Law degree (LLB) at the University of Pretoria in 2016. She joined Wessels + Van Zyl Inc. in 2017 as a candidate attorney, was admitted as an attorney of the High Court in 2019 and currently serves in our firm’s Commercial Department.

 During her time at University, Suré was on the Dean’s List of Merits for Exceptional Academic Achievement as well as a Member of the Golden Key International Honour Society for Academic Achievement. She also dedicated her free time as tutor in the University’s Department of Private Law where she presented tutorials and lectures in Law of Contracts and Law of Succession.

 She further completed an Advanced Diploma in Trust and Estate Administration from the University of the Free State in 2020.

 Suré is currently part of the commercial department, where she attends to amongst other things, drafting commercial agreements and attending to all secretarial services in relation to registering and amending company documents, directors and shareholders.

 She is also a member of the Fiduciary Institute of South Africa and specializes in providing clients with advice regarding trust and estate planning, structuring personal estates in a tax efficient way, attending to the registration of new trusts, amending trustees or trust deeds, ensuring that trust deeds are in accordance with current trust legislation, estate planning, drafting of wills and the administration of deceased estates.
